Here is a list of top 5 jungle safari destinations for holidays-
1- RANTHAMBORE NATIONAL PARK, RAJASTHAN- It is one of the top National Parks in India. This is the largest park in the Northern India. Ranthambore National Park is famous for Royal Bengal Tigers. It is a huge wildlife reserve near the town of Sawai Madhopur in Rajasthan. This park is getting popular day by day not only because of its tiger population but other attractions also such as its rich vegetation and for different species of birds and animals. The best way of discovering the park and seeing its wildlife is a jungle safari ride. Its wildlife consists of tigers, leopards, hyenas, jackals, sloth bear, Foxes etc. and wide range of birds such as pelicans, ibis, flamingos, cranes etc. This park is open for visitors from October to June, but the perfect time to watch the tigers is from March to May.
2- JIM CORBETT, UTTARAKHAND- Jim Corbett is Asia’s first National park. People from different countries visit here from all over the world. It has a great population of tigers. Besides tigers there are other many more wild species of animals and birds. Best time to visit Jim Corbett is November to June.
3- BANDHAVGARH NATIONAL PARK, MADHYA PRADESH- Like Ranthambore Bandhavgarh National Park is also famous for Royal Bengal Tigers. It is counted among best places for wildlife safari in India. It has well maintained and protected environment for wild creatures to live and prosper. For visiting Bandhavgarh wild life park is from October toJune.
4- KAZIRANGA NATIONAL PARK, ASSAM- Assam is a beautiful place full of peace and greenery and among this if there is a National Park then it will be great fun. If you want to spend your holiday in such surroundings then Kaziranga National Park is a perfect place to explore. Kaziranga National Park is famous for one horned Rhinoceros in the world. Other than Rhinos it consists of Elephants, Bears, Panthers, Leopards and other beautiful bird species. It has beautiful landscapes. The ideal time to visit Kaziranga is from November to April.
5- PERIYAR WILDLIFE SANCTUARY, KERALA- This wildlife sanctuary is located in the segment of the Western Ghats in Kerala. It offers a beautiful environment to its populations. There are large number of tigers to watch and also very large counts of bird species to see. You can also do boating around the park to see the animals closely such as Elephants. This sanctuary is open throughout the year but September to December is the best time to visit.
